The crystal structure of the large ribosomal subunit from Deinococcus radiodurans complexed with the pleuromutilin derivative retapamulin (SB-275833)The crystal structure of the large ribosomal subunit from Deinococcus radiodurans complexed with the pleuromutilin derivative retapamulin (SB-275833)

2ogo is a 1 chain structure of Ribosomal protein L3 and Ribosomal protein L6 with sequence from Deinococcus radiodurans. Full crystallographic information is available from OCA.
